일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- rxswift
- map
- swift documentation
- combine
- ribs
- Xcode
- UICollectionView
- ios
- SWIFT
- 애니메이션
- Human interface guide
- 리펙토링
- HIG
- 리펙터링
- collectionview
- 클린 코드
- Clean Code
- tableView
- 스위프트
- 리팩토링
- RxCocoa
- swiftUI
- Protocol
- Observable
- uitableview
- UITextView
- clean architecture
- MVVM
- Refactoring
- uiscrollview
- Today
- Total
목록모달 (2)
김종권의 iOS 앱 개발 알아가기
over가 붙은 것과 붙지 않은 것의 차이 over가 붙은 것은 띄우는 VC의 view들을 날리지 않고 바로 띄우는 것이고, over가 붙지 않으면 띄우는 VC의 뷰들을 날림 파란색 VC를 fullScreen로 띄운 경우 이전에 있던 UIView들을 날림 (아래 사진에서 두 개의 UITransitionView가 있을 때, 첫 번째 UITransitionView의 UIDropShadowView의 View들이 날아감) 파란색 VC를 overFullScreen으로 띄운 경우 파란색 VC앞에 있던 뷰들이 사라지지 않고 유지되어 있음 -over를 붙이면 앞전의 view들이 사라있고, -over를 붙이지 않으면 view들이 사라짐 -> 띄울 VC에서 viewWillAppear 프린트를 찍을때, 파란색 VC를 dis..
CustomPopup 구현 아이디어 팝업을 띄울 때, MyPopupViewController를 modal로 present하여, 팝업 주의를 탭해도 이벤트를 받지 않도록 설정 MyPopupViewController에는 커스텀 팝업 UI인 MyPopupView를 가지고 있으며, 이 view의 layout은 화면에 꽉 차게끔 auto layout 사용 MyPopupView에서는 poupView라는 UIView를 넣고, 이 뷰의 layout은 left, right, centerT값만 정하여 높이값은 내부 뷰들 (label, button)들의 intrinsic content size에 맞게 알아서 높이가 정해지도록 구현 구현에서 코드로 편리하게 UI를 구현하기 위해 사용한 프레임워크) pod 'SnapKit' p..